Selflessness
I saw a Twitter post yesterday from @lecrae, a Christian hip-hop artist who tweeted:
Hey (insert clever quote) Look at me! ( insert joke) I'm insecure. (insert deep quote) Admire me. (insert spiritual jargon).
Which he then followed up with the tweet:
Gotta love Twitter. It tells the truth in more ways than one.
I spent some time reflecting on that because a lot of my posts on my blog/Facebook/Twitter end up about me, what I'm doing and what I'm thinking (including this one!). I had to wonder if it's all for the purpose of selfishness, drawing attention to one's self.
Contrast that to Carolyn's recent blog posts which have showcased her own challenge of doing the "Love Dare". She started doing this daily "Love Dare" for Lent which has her focusing on one loving action towards her husband (me) each day for 40 days. She's been keeping a running blog report of how things go each day. It's humbling being on the receiving end of this as each day she does something to love me, even when I'm being self-centered. Ultimately it points to how God's grace is at work in her life as it pertains to our marriage, but it also demonstrates how much better of a wife she is than I am of a husband. I'm so grateful for her.
